Quando gli animali non avevano la coda

by Roveda Anselmo, Civardi Elisabetta
Quando gli animali non avevano la coda

A long time ago, animals had no tail. But it was a big problem: the dog could not wag his tail to the master, the fox could not make himself beautiful, the horse could not chase flies away… So one day the lion gathered his subjects and distributed tails to everyone. The first ones received the best tails, the last ones…

A tale of African tradition reinterpreted in a modern and fun way about the importance of what sometimes seems like a detail. Colored animals inhabit a new city and surprise us with their unusual morals which, at times, seem to give an imaginative explanation to the strange laws of the world.

Roveda Anselmo, Civardi Elisabetta

Anselmo Roveda is a journalist and author from Genoa. He is the editorial coordinator of the monthly journal “Andersen”. Among his books, Nino e la mafia (Coccole Books) and Le avventure dei pirati di Capitan Salgari (EDT Giralangolo).

Elisabetta Civardi lives and works in Genoa where she was artistically trained between comics, illustrated books and contemporary painting. She also realizes artistic workshops for children from 2 to 16 years old.
